Ruby Test Unit Vs Minitest

Getting Started With Testing In Rails Using Minitest And Rspec By Ethan Ryan Medium

Getting Started With Testing In Rails Using Minitest And Rspec By Ethan Ryan Medium

Rspec Or Minitest For Testing Rails Apps Dev

Rspec Or Minitest For Testing Rails Apps Dev

Why Minitest Is Way Better Than Rspec Codementor

Why Minitest Is Way Better Than Rspec Codementor

Github Quirkey Minitest Display Patches Minitest To Allow For An Easily Configurable Output For Ruby 1 9 D

Github Quirkey Minitest Display Patches Minitest To Allow For An Easily Configurable Output For Ruby 1 9 D

Assert Testing With Ruby S Minitest Dev

Assert Testing With Ruby S Minitest Dev

On Rspec Minitest And Doing Magic Right Dev

On Rspec Minitest And Doing Magic Right Dev

On Rspec Minitest And Doing Magic Right Dev

There are a number of different approaches to this problem and i don t believe there s wide consensus on the best way.

Ruby test unit vs minitest.

Mutant minitest minitest integration for mutant. A good unit test is. The hellotest class extends test unit testcase which is where the magic that turns this class into a dsl. Shoulda style syntax for minitest test unit.

Minitest tu shim bridges between test unit and minitest. After using rspec for several projects i m giving minitest unit a go. The articletest class defines a test case because it inherits from activesupport testcase articletest thus has all the methods available from activesupport testcase later in this guide we ll see some of the methods it gives us. I m liking it so far but i miss using describe context blocks to group my tests specs in a logical way.

Any method defined within a class inherited from minitest test which is the superclass of activesupport testcase that begins with test is simply called a test. Minitest is a complete testing suite for ruby supporting test driven development tdd behavior driven development bdd mocking and benchmarking. We need to write a method that implements the math. When this file is executed eg.

I know minitest spec provides this functionality but i like that minitest unit feels a bit closer to barebones ruby. Measurenametest minitest test fails on 64 bit ruby 200 on windows nrel openstudio 1345 open seattlerb locked and limited conversation to collaborators may 17 2017. Mongoid minitest minitest matchers for mongoid. Minitest 是什么 不懂的请搜索一下 我就不解释了 在 minitest 之前 用 ruby 做测试的有两种人 一种人喜欢 test unit 的test 风格 另一种人喜欢 rspec 的describe风格 他们时不时因为这两种风格的优缺点以及哪一方才能代表真正的 ruby 测试风格而争执不下.

So the complex part of your situation is that you have one thing surgery that can be of many different types and the different types have different fields. Today we ll be writing our unit tests with minitest an add on to the standard ruby built in classes. Written at the time your code is written sometimes before tests one thing so that when it fails you know what went wrong. Pry rescue a pry plugin w minitest support.

It s small fast and it aims to make tests clean and readable. Tagged with beginners ruby testing tutorial. This method is approximately 10x slower than capture io so only use it when you need to test the output of a subprocess.

Practice Writing Your Own Tests In Ruby By Vakas Akhtar Sep 2020 Medium

Practice Writing Your Own Tests In Ruby By Vakas Akhtar Sep 2020 Medium

Minitest Writing Test Code In Ruby 2 3 Dev

Minitest Writing Test Code In Ruby 2 3 Dev

Bow Before Minitest Speaker Deck

Bow Before Minitest Speaker Deck

Using Minitest Springerlink

Using Minitest Springerlink

Source : pinterest.com